Vulnerability Description

A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, has been found in DouPHP 1.7 Release 20220822. Affected by this issue is some unknown functionality of the file /admin/system.php of the component Favicon Handler. The manipulation of the argument site_favicon leads to unrestricted upload. The attack may be launched rem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
